Rails supports self-referential associations where a model can reference itself within the same database table, allowing complex hierarchical relationships like managers and employees in a single table. This feature simplifies managing structures such as nested comments or organizational hierarchies by explicitly defining foreign keys and class names to guide Rails on how to interpret these relationships.
